With the victory, China lead Group C with three points and two goals, followed by favorites South Korea who only edged the minnows Philippines 1-0.
South Korea got the winner in the 67th minute when Hwang Ui-jo struck the ball from close range into the net at the Al-Maktoum Stadium in Dubai.
The Philippine footballers directed by former England coach Sven-Goran Eriksson showcased very tough defense in the duel.
